The Cimarron LT is the next evolution in Ross’s legendary Cimarron family—rebuilt from the frame out with aggressive porting, a refined aluminum drag knob, and premium in-house anodizing done right here in Colorado. Designed for everyday freshwater performance, it combines classic styling with a powerful, adjustable composite-disc drag system built to protect 7X tippet and stand up to fast-water battles on 0X. Lightweight, durable, and 100% American-made, it’s the reel trout anglers can count on, season after season.
Key Features:
-
Lighter-weight construction through aggressive porting
-
Large arbor design for quick line pickup
-
Cimarron Mountain landscape machine milled into frame
-
Smooth composite disc drag system with stainless steel interface
-
Anodized aluminum drag knob and escapement cover for added durability
-
Balances well with modern rods while protecting light tippet
-
Available in sizes 4/5, 5/6, 7/8 in core colors Matte Black, Matte Platinum, Matte Blue, Matte Olive
-
Made in Montrose, CO
